Why Do-It-Yourself Concrete Work Can Be Dangerous
Whilst the appeal of saving money on residential upgrade projects can be appealing, DIY concrete work frequently involves significant risks. Many homeowners misjudge the complexity inherent in mixing, pouring, and finishing concrete. Improper measurements or poor preparation can produce uneven surfaces, cracks, and structural issues that may require high-priced repairs. Moreover, the physical demands of the job can present safety hazards, causing potential injuries from heavy lifting or improper equipment use. Environmental factors, such as temperature and humidity, also play a crucial role in the curing process, which a novice may not sufficiently account for. Additionally, lacking the right tools and materials can undermine the overall quality of the project. Ultimately, these risks underscore the importance of considering professional help to secure a durable and aesthetically pleasing concrete installation. The ramifications of a poorly executed DIY project can far outweigh any initial savings.

How Premium Tools Elevate Project Performance
Professional-grade tools play an important role in determining the success of concrete projects. When contractors utilize premium equipment, they achieve precision in measurements and finishes, which directly affects the durability and aesthetics of the final product. Tools such as power mixers, trowels, and vibrating screeds are engineered to increase efficiency and effectiveness, providing smoother surfaces and more consistent mixes.
Moreover, quality tools decrease the chance of errors during the concrete pouring and curing procedures. This lessens the risk of costly repairs and reworks, consequently saving time and resources. Professional concrete contractors utilize advanced machinery that can adapt to various project needs, assuring excellent results regardless of the complexities involved. In addition, well-maintained tools improve safety on-site, as they are less inclined to malfunction. In summary, the use of quality tools substantially raises the standard of concrete work, resulting in superior project outcomes and client satisfaction.

Common Questions
Which Types of Concrete Projects Do Professional Contractors Typically Manage?
Skilled contractors generally oversee numerous concrete projects, including foundations, driveways, patios, sidewalks, retaining walls, and decorative surfaces. They hold the experience to guarantee structural integrity, professional installation, and compliance with local codes and standards for all concrete applications.
How Can I Find a Dependable Concrete Contractor in My Region?
To discover a reputable concrete contractor, you should obtain recommendations from loved ones, check online reviews, validate credentials, and request quotes from a number of contractors to assess services and pricing before making a decision.
What Should I Expect During a Concrete Project Consultation?
Throughout a concrete project consultation, you can expect an copyrightination of the property, discussion of project goals and budget, material choices, timelines, and comprehensive descriptions of the workflow and likely issues.
Are There Specific Certifications to Look for in a Concrete Contractor?
Indeed, clients should check for certifications such as ACI (American Concrete Institute) and NRMCA (the National Ready Mixed Concrete Association) when selecting concrete contractors, as these reflect professionalism, commitment to industry standards, and expertise in projects involving concrete.
How Does Climate Affect Concrete Installation and Curing?
Weather factors considerably affect concrete pouring and curing. Severe temperatures, humidity, and precipitation can compromise the curing process, resulting in inferior structures, improper setting, and likely cracking, underscoring the need for strategic planning and timing.
